his immersive Arequipa Countryside Half-Day Tour provides an authentic look at the region’s agricultural and colonial heritage. The itinerary includes a visit to the remarkably preserved 17th-century Sabandía Mill, featuring original, functional ashlar architecture and colonial-era grinding mechanisms powered by river water. The journey continues to the Paucarpata terraces, ancient Pre-Inca agricultural structures still in use, offering spectacular 360-degree views of the valley and the majestic Misti, Chachani, and Pichu Pichu volcanoes. The tour concludes at the historic Founder’s Mansion, one of Southern Peru's most significant colonial residences.

Step back in time as you walk the half-meter-thick walls of the Sabandía Mill and witness a 400-year-old process still in motion, interacting with the families who preserve these ancient trades. Feel the profound connection to the Earth at Paucarpata, where you stand on the same terraces built by the Incas over 500 years ago, appreciating the ingenious hydraulic systems that sustain life today. The final stop, the Founder's Mansion, opens a portal to the viceregal nobility, allowing you to wander elegant courtyards and noble halls while hearing fascinating family legends and secrets that defined the colonial era.

This tour is essential for travelers seeking to understand the deep ties between Arequipa's urban beauty and its powerful rural identity. 9:00 am – Sabandía Mill: Where Time Stood Still

We arrive at the picturesque district of Sabandía, where one of Arequipa’s best-preserved colonial treasures awaits you:

  • Living architecture of the 17th century: Admire the perfect symmetry of the mill, built entirely of ashlar, with its half-meter-thick walls that have withstood earthquakes and the passage of time.

  • Original Mechanisms: See the enormous grinding stones, water wheels, and wooden gears that still work as they did in colonial times.

  • Traditional Process: Learn how water from the Sabandía River is channeled to move the blades and grind the grain, following a system that hasn’t changed in 400 years.

  • Andean Gardens: Stroll through the beautiful gardens surrounding the mill, with native flowers and ancient trees.

  • Rural Panorama: Enjoy spectacular views of the valley, with the imposing Misti volcano presiding over the landscape.

  • Local Interaction: Meet the families who have cared for this mill for generations and hear their stories about life in the Arequipa countryside.

10:00 am – Paucarpata Lookout: Terraces that Embrace the Sky

We head to Arequipa’s most impressive natural viewpoint, where the hand of man and nature created a joint masterpiece:

  • Pre-Inca Terraces: See the fascinating agricultural terraces that the Incas built more than 500 years ago, still in use today.

  • Ancestral irrigation system: Observe the water channels that run between the terraces, a demonstration of Andean hydraulic ingenuity.

  • Traditional crops: Identify quinoa, corn, beans, and other crops that grow on these ancient terraces.

  • 360-degree panorama: Enjoy unparalleled views of the valleys, volcanoes (Misti, Chachani, Pichu Pichu) and the city of Arequipa in the distance.

  • Spectacular photography: Capture the perfect geometry of the terraces that look like stairs to heaven.

  • Living Culture: Watch local farmers work the land using pre-Columbian techniques, keeping an ancient tradition alive.

11:00 am – Founder’s Mansion: Portal to the Colonial Past

We delve into one of the most important and best-preserved colonial mansions in southern Peru, where every corner tells the story of the conquistadors and the viceregal nobility:

  • Exceptional colonial architecture: Explore the spacious courtyards with their elegant arcades, central fountains, and gardens designed according to the principles of Renaissance architecture.

  • Noble Halls: Admire the carved wooden ceilings, murals depicting the conquest, and original 17th-century furniture.

  • Private Chapel: Visit the family chapel with its baroque altar and religious images that have been venerated for more than 10 generations.

  • Colonial Kitchen: Discover the enormous kitchen with its stove, period utensils, and the oven where viceregal banquets were prepared.

  • Portrait Gallery: See portraits of the founders and their descendants, dressed in traditional colonial-era attire.

  • Living History: Hear fascinating stories about the daily lives of the colonial nobility, their traditions, festivals, and family secrets.

How is this Countryside Tour different from the Arequipa City Tour?

While the City Tour focuses on the urban center and the Santa Catalina Monastery, the Countryside Tour (Ruta del Sillar y la Campiña) takes you out of the city limits to explore Arequipa’s rural and agricultural heritage. You will visit sprawling colonial estates like the Founder's Mansion, the functioning Sabandía water mill, and the ancient pre-Inca farming terraces (andenes) of Paucarpata. Does the Sabandía Mill still actually work?

Yes, it does! The Sabandía Mill (El Molino de Sabandía) is a masterpiece of colonial engineering built entirely out of sillar (white volcanic stone) in the 17th century. During your visit, you won't just look at a static museum; you will see the ancient stone wheels turning, powered by the waters of the Sabandía River, exactly as they have for the last 400 years.
